BREAKING: LEVEL Launches New Direct Route from Barcelona to Lima (Peru)

Great news for European travellers! The low-cost long-haul carrier LEVEL has officially announced a massive expansion to its South American network. Starting in June 2026, you can fly non-stop from Barcelona (BCN) to Lima (LIM), Peru.

This new connection is a game-changer for budget travellers. Historically, reaching Peru from Europe required expensive flights with legacy carriers or long layovers in cities like Madrid, Bogota, or Sao Paulo. With this new direct service, the wonders of the Andes are closer—and more affordable—than ever before.

Flight Details & Schedule

  • Airline: LEVEL (part of the IAG Group, alongside Iberia and British Airways)
  • Route: Barcelona El Prat (BCN) – Lima Jorge Chávez (LIM)
  • Flight Type: Non-stop / Direct
  • Launch Date: June 2026
  • Booking Status: Tickets are on sale now!

Prices have been spotted starting as low as €306 one-way, making this one of the most competitive options for crossing the Atlantic to the Pacific coast of South America.

What to Expect Flying LEVEL

If you haven’t flown with LEVEL before, it is important to know that they operate on a low-cost model. This allows them to offer such attractive base fares, but it means you only pay for what you need.

  • The Aircraft: LEVEL typically operates modern Airbus A330 aircraft on long-haul routes, offering a comfortable ride with personal entertainment screens at every seat.
  • Baggage: The cheapest “Light” fares usually include only a piece of hand luggage (cabin bag) and a personal item. Checked baggage is an optional extra.
  • Meals: On the lowest fare classes, meals and drinks may not be included. We recommend pre-booking a meal package online or bringing your own snacks to save money.
  • Wi-Fi: Most LEVEL flights offer paid Wi-Fi connectivity options.

Why June 2026 is the Perfect Time to Go

The launch of this route in June coincides perfectly with the prime travel season in Peru.

  1. Dry Season in the Andes: June is the start of the dry winter season in the Peruvian Andes. This is widely considered the best time to visit Machu Picchu and Cusco, as you are likely to have clear blue skies and sunny days—perfect for hiking the Inca Trail or taking that bucket-list photo.
  2. Inti Raymi Festival: If you travel in late June, you might catch the Inti Raymi (Festival of the Sun) in Cusco, one of the biggest and most colourful traditional festivals in South America.

Destination Guide: Why Visit Lima?

Many travellers treat Lima just as a layover hub, but the Peruvian capital is a destination in its own right.

  • The Gastronomic Capital: Lima is arguably the food capital of the world. From high-end restaurants like Central (frequently voted #1 in the world) to affordable street stalls selling Anticuchos (grilled skewers), the food scene is incredible. Don’t leave without trying authentic Ceviche.
  • Miraflores & Barranco: Stay in Miraflores for stunning views of the Pacific Ocean from the Malecón cliffs. For a more bohemian vibe, head to Barranco, known for its street art, colourful colonial mansions, and vibrant nightlife.
  • History Downtown: Visit the historic city centre (Plaza Mayor) to see the Government Palace and the catacombs of the San Francisco Monastery.
